面向6G的星地融合网络架构

摘要:通过对卫星星座的发展和星地融合网络研究的回顾,明确了6G的星地融合网络的发展趋势,提出了智简赋能的6G网络体系架构和弹性可重构的6G星地融合架构,并分析了星地融合网络中的关键技术问题,包括星上轻量化虚拟化技术、星上边缘计算功能以及广播/多播技术。认为6G星地融合网络将通过星地协同实现网络资源和计算资源的统一调度,同时可以根据业务需求和网络状态智能实现网络功能的按需弹性部署。

关键词:6G网络架构;星地融合网络架构;边缘计算;广播/多播

 

Abstract: Through a review of the development of satellite constellations and research on the integrated satellite and terrestrial networks, the trend of the integrated satellite and terrestrial networks for 6G is put forward. An intelligent simplicity empowerment 6G network architecture and a resilient and reconfigurable integrated satellite and terrestrial architecture are proposed. Then the key technical issues in the integrated satellite and terrestrial networks, including lightweight virtualization technology onboard satellites, onboard edge computing function, and broadcast/multicast technology are analyzed. It is believed that 6G integrated satellite and terrestrial networks will achieve unified scheduling of network and computing resources through satellite-terrestrial cooperation and can intelligently deploy network functions flexibly according to service requirements and network conditions.

Keywords: 6G network architecture; integrated satellite and terrestrial network architecture; edge computing; broadcast/multicast
